AuthorI was born in Terengganu, Malaysia in 1969. Married with 3 children and now working as a risk surveyor. My kampung is known as Sungai Buaya as they believe there was a white crocodile guarding the river. Once, when I was 7 years old, I was drown inside the river, and luckily I survived. Being a kampung boy, living near a river, I started indulging with fishing and activies that associated with river. During the monson seasoon, I moved to paddy field looking for freshwater species like keli, haruan, sepat, selat etc. My father used to sailing back and forth to Siam (Thailand) and sometimes encountered with pirates. The boat can only be seen idle at the local marine museum at Bukit Losong, Terengganu. 

My fishing didn't stop when I went to Hartford, Connecticut for study. I managed to catch some trouts, bass and even got a chance to see the great humpback whale in Cape Code, Maine.
